Restaurant Summary

The room feels warm and bustling without tipping into chaos, with bar seats by the oven offering front-row views of blistering pies. Service is often friendly and on-point, though peak nights can stretch waits. One diner summed it up: "Worth the hype for the crust and the vibe." The cooking leans artisan and market-led rather than flashy: long-fermented dough, careful toppings like hot honey with pepperoni, and sides that show California produce. It suits those who appreciate craft over quantity and are happy to settle in while the oven works; dine-in is best, as takeout can lose its snap. Families do well here thanks to a kids cheese pizza and broadly friendly staff. Picky eaters can stick to Margherita, Caesar, and simple sides; adventurous diners will enjoy seasonal pies and veg. Reserve early for prime times and ask for indoor seating if patio chairs are not your thing.

MontecitoMontecito is an upscale residential neighborhood known for its luxury estates, boutique hotels, and high-end dining options. The area offers a relaxed yet sophisticated dining atmosphere, often frequented by well-heeled locals and visitors looking for quality and exclusivity.
Coast Village RoadCoast Village Road is the main commercial strip in Montecito, featuring a collection of restaurants, cafes, and shops with a relaxed, small-town feel. It is a popular spot for both casual meals and special occasions, blending a laid-back vibe with refined culinary experiences.
